Common Name | Oxirane, 2-butyl- | ||
---|---|---|---|---|
CAS Number | 1436-34-6 | Molecular Weight | 100.15900 | |
Density | 0.833 g/mL at 20 °C(lit.) | Boiling Point | 118-120 °C(lit.) | |
Molecular Formula | C6H12O | Melting Point | N/A | |
MSDS | Chinese USA | Flash Point | 60 °F | |
Symbol |
![]() ![]() GHS02, GHS07 |
Signal Word | Danger |

Continuous production of enantiopure 1,2-epoxyhexane by yeast epoxide hydrolase in a two-phase membrane bioreactor.
Appl. Microbiol. Biotechnol. 54(5) , 641-6, (2000) A two-phase membrane bioreactor was developed to continuously produce enantiopure epoxides using the epoxide hydrolase activity of Rhodotorula glutinis. Cloning and characterization of an epoxide hydrolase from Cupriavidus metallidurans-CH34.
Protein Expr. Purif. 79(1) , 49-59, (2011) A putative epoxide hydrolase-encoding gene was identified from the genome sequence of Cupriavidus metallidurans CH34.
